ASR回环评估被广泛用作文本转语音(TTS)可懂性的可扩展代理,但可能产生听者感知到的朗读错误的假阴性。本文研究了中文新闻语音中依赖上下文或领域惯例正确朗读的片段,如体育比分、飞机型号、技术单位和会员名称。在这些情况下,原始TTS可能选择看似合理但错误的读法,而ASR却将其转录为预期或表面正确的文本。针对110个高风险MiMo TTS案例的定向审计(含完整基数)确认:46例被掩盖的假阴性、9例暴露的TTS错误、55例无错误。语段隔离诊断重新暴露了其中18/46例先前被掩盖的错误。对同一数据集进行仅基于Raw TTS的CosyVoice审计,确认51例被掩盖的错误。在97个经双重审计确认被掩盖的TTS音频中,Qwen3-ASR表面恢复了40例,而Paraformer仅恢复2例。结果表明,ASR回环评估适用于筛查,但不足以作为中文新闻朗读风险评估的独立真实标准。
原文摘要 · Abstract (English)
ASR-roundtrip evaluation is widely used as a scalable proxy for text-to-speech (TTS) intelligibility, but it can produce false negatives for reading errors perceived by listeners. We study Chinese news TTS spans whose correct reading depends on context or domain conventions, such as sports scores, aircraft models, technical units, and membership names. In these cases, Raw TTS can choose a plausible but wrong reading while ASR transcribes the audio as the intended or surface-correct text. A targeted audit over 110 high-risk MiMo TTS cases, reported with a complete denominator, confirms 46 masked false negatives, 9 exposed TTS errors, and 55 cases with no Raw TTS error. A span-isolation diagnostic re-exposes 18/46 previously masked errors. A Raw-only CosyVoice audit on the same targeted pool confirms 51 masked cases. Across the 97 TTS-specific audio files labeled confirmed masked across the two audits, Qwen3-ASR surface-recovers 40 cases, whereas Paraformer does so in only 2. The results suggest that ASR-roundtrip is useful for screening but insufficient as standalone ground truth for Chinese news reading-risk evaluation.
